What companies run services between Exeter, England and Cahors, France?

You can take a train from Exeter St Davids to Cahors via London Paddington, Paddington, King's Cross St. Pancras station, London St Pancras Intl, Paris Nord, Gare du Nord, Montparnasse Bienvenue,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2, and Montauban Ville Bourbon in around 12h 54m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bampfylde Street to Cahors via London Victoria, Paris, and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station in around 22h 36m.
